For a sports team, having a celebrity fan can go a long way. It can bring attention, fanfare, and exposure to your club, sometimes even pushing the team to the next level. Other times, however, a celebrity sports fan can attract a lot of attention for the wrong reasons.

Drake, the Canadian rap sensation, has apparently been "cursing" sports teams and players for years. The joke goes that if you take a picture with Drake, or if he shows support for your team, you will lose or perform badly.

But with the NBA finals coming to an incredible close after an extremely tight run, the Toronto Raptors, Drake’s most favorite team, took home the trophy and made Canadian history. Not to mention the victory was in true Drake fashion, as the team from the “6ix” won it all in Game 6.

“This is poetic … the ‘6ix’ in six, Kyle Lowry with the ring, Kawhi Leonard bringing my chips to the city. I want my chips with the dip!” the rapper told interviewers hungry for his reaction to the big win.

A longtime courtside staple at Raptors games, Drake had been cited as part of the reason that the team never previously made it to the finals. On his track ‘30 for 30 Freestyle’ he raps, "I got a club in the Raptors arena / Championships, celebrations during regular seasons."

While it might be easy to think that the curse has been dispelled with this triumphant victory for Drake’s home team, he might have had some bad luck in store for the Golden State Warriors as well.

If the Drake curse is real, the odds were stacked equally against the Raptors’ competition, as the rapper was also a big fan of the Warriors. He mentions the team in his song ‘Summer Sixteen,’ and he raps about “Steph Curry with the shot” in ‘0-100/The Catch Up.’ He also gives a shout-out to Kevin Durant, from his Oklahoma City Thunder days, in ‘Weston Road Flows.’ Durant was injured this season, and Curry missed that last critical three-pointer, the shot he effortlessly made numerous times throughout the game…
